We have partnered with the Indiana Department of Natural Resources to promote a special package. When you purchase a membership for $55.00 to The Farm at Prophetstown, you will also receive a state park pass that is good for free admission to ALL Indiana State Parks through 2024! The Farm makes $12 from each of these memberships to support the organization and our events. Also available for purchase is a farm membership sticker only (no park pass included) for $15.00. Please keep in mind you will be required to pay gate fees to enter the park and visit the farm (including for our dinners) if you don’t have a park pass. Entrance into the park is $8.

Membership benefits include:

  • Invitation to our annual meeting and end of the year celebration.
  • Newsletters and other email updates regarding farm activities.
  • Special running discounts and other member priority events.
  • Unlimited free admission to The Farm, Prophetstown State Park, and all other Indiana state parks!
